Welcome to Rush Creek Valley ...

Rush Creek Valley is located in Washington County<1>.

While we don't have a date for the founding of Rush Creek Valley, you might consider that their post office opened in 1871.

A typical abbreviation for Rush Creek Valley: Rush Crk. Vly. (or less commonly used: Rush Ck. Vly. or Rush Cr. Vly.)

Rush Creek Valley is 540 feet [165 m] above sea level.<2>.

Time Zone: Rush Creek Valley lies in the Eastern Time Zone (EST/EDT) and observes daylight saving time

Note: If you travel south from Rush Creek Valley (for example, toward Irvington (KY)), you will leave Eastern Time and cross into the Central Time Zone (CST/CDT).

Area Codes for Rush Creek Valley: 812 & 930<3>

Adding Rush Creek Valley to Our Gazetteer ...

We originally found mention of Rush Creek Valley in both the FIPS-55 and the GNIS. For more information, see the FIPS and GNIS Codes sections on our Miscellaneous Page.

From our notes, the earliest published mention we've found (so far) for Rush Creek Valley was in the document titled List of Post Offices from Cameron Blevins and Richard Helbock.<5>

From that list, the Rush Creek Valley post office opened in 1871. The Rush Creek Valley post office closed in 1901.

<3>When there's a risk of an area code running out of phone numbers, an 'Overlay Area Code' is created that has the same geographic boundaries as the existing area code. In this case, the 812 code has been Overlayed with the 930 area code. New phone numbers in the Rush Creek Valley area will be assigned with one of these codes: 812 or 930. As a result, placing a call in the Rush Creek Valley area will require 10-digit dialing (where you enter both the area code and then the phone number).
